Vb.net报警控件
时间: 2024-09-16 19:01:42 浏览: 71
Vb.NET中的报警控件通常是指用于显示通知、警告或信息的用户界面元素,比如Windows Forms中的`MessageBox`(消息框),或者更专业的`NotifyIcon`(托盘图标通知)。它们允许开发者向用户传达临时的重要信息,而不打断当前应用程序的操作流程。
`MessageBox`是最基础的控件,提供几种预设的样式(如信息、警告、错误等)供选择,并可以包含简单的文本消息和可能的确认或取消按钮。`NotifyIcon`则更为高级,可以在任务栏上显示一个图标,并通过它弹出气泡提示或者右键菜单,让用户在后台查看并管理警报。
在Vb.NET中,你可以像这样创建一个简单的消息框:
```vb.net
Dim result As DialogResult = MessageBox.Show("这是一个警告消息", "警告", MessageBoxButtons.OKCancel)
```
如果你需要更复杂的交互,如在托盘区域展示通知,可以使用`System.Windows.Forms.NotifyIcon`类:
```vb.net
Dim notifyIcon As New NotifyIcon()
notifyIcon.Icon = SystemIcons.Asterisk ' 设置图标
notifyIcon.BalloonTipText = "有新的警报!" ' 显示气球提示内容
notifyIcon.Visible = True ' 显示通知
```
相关问题
wincc的.net 控件
WinCC是西门子公司开发的人机界面软件,可用于监控和控制自动化系统。WinCC提供了丰富的功能和工具,帮助用户创建直观、灵活和易于使用的人机界面。
WinCC的.NET控件是WinCC中的一个模块,它基于.NET技术开发,提供了一组可用于自定义和扩展WinCC界面的控件。这些控件可以通过编程接口与WinCC的运行时环境进行交互,实现更复杂的功能和操作。
通过WinCC的.NET控件,用户可以根据自己的需求设计和创建自定义的界面元素,如按钮、图表、列表等。这些控件可以根据用户的要求进行布局、样式和交互等方面的设置,使界面更加美观和易于使用。
在WinCC的.NET控件中,用户可以使用C#或VB.NET等语言进行编程,实现各种功能,如数据采集、报警处理、数据可视化等。通过与WinCC系统的通信接口,用户可以实时获取和处理系统中的数据,实现系统的监控和控制。
同时,WinCC的.NET控件还提供了丰富的图形库和动画效果,可以为界面增加更多的交互和视觉效果,提升用户体验。
总而言之,WinCC的.NET控件是一个强大的工具,可以帮助用户实现更灵活和定制化的人机界面,提供更好的操作和监控体验。通过编程和功能扩展,用户可以根据自己的需求来定制自己的界面,实现更高效和智能的控制系统。
阅读全文